Abstract
This is a last part of the series of articles on Portuguese expansion in North America during the era of Great Discoveries. The article is devoted to the events of the 1520s as well as to the first attempt to create a permanent Portuguese settlement on the territory of present day Canadian Atlantic Provinces. Special attention is given to expeditions and activity of Joao Fagundes who was of one of the leading organizers of this enterprise. It also analyses the reasons of the failure of the Portuguese colony and the reasons of the general decrease of Portuguese colonial activity in this region.
